Showing results for 
Search instead for 
Did you mean: 
Regular Visitor

Flow to Add Update Delete items from Excel to SharePoin

Hi I am creating a flow to Add Update Delete items from Excel to SharePoint

Excel table



Sharepoint List



Name column is the key.

I want the flow delete the 3rd row, add "Joe" row and update the country cell in 2nd row of Sharepoint.

 The Sharepoint list will perform like Excel table.


and this is my reference video:

at the last process,

when I entry item()?[‘Data2']

the error message shows The expression is valid 


Could you please help me with any option . 


Super User
Super User


Are you saying that you want the SharePoint list to be identical to the Excel table?  If so, can you tell me why you want to update the country in the second SharePoint row?  It is Canada in both Excel and SharePoint.

Also, if there aren't a lot of rows, it might be much easier to delete all items in the SharePoint list and repopulate it from Excel.

How is your Flow being triggered?  Recurrence? 



If I have answered your question, please mark your post as Solved.
If you like my response, please give it a Thumbs Up.


Hi ScottShearer

I'm sorry it's my typo, the Canada in row 2 of Excel should be "England" and anything else.

And actually, in my list, there are 3000 rows.

Ideally, I want to Recurrence as the excel sheet uploaded to sharepoint.


Helpful resources

MPA Virtual Workshop Carousel 768x460.png

Register for a Free Workshop

Learn to digitize and optimize business processes and connect all your applications to share data in real time.

Power automate tips 768x460 v2.png

Restore a Deleted Flow

Did you know that you could restore a deleted flow? Check out this helpful article.

Microsoft Build 768x460.png

Microsoft Build is May 24-26. Have you registered yet?

Come together to explore latest innovations in code and application development—and gain insights from experts from around the world.

May UG Leader Call Carousel 768x460.png

What difference can a User Group make for you?

At the monthly call, connect with other leaders and find out how community makes your experience even better.

Users online (2,449)